Transaction 7ae5765ffca625f03f7ea80609e2defd8ef9fc656c5c9a32c713479518bfa9ac

1 Input
2 Outputs
  • 7ae5765ffca625f03f7ea80609e2defd8ef9fc656c5c9a32c713479518bfa9ac:0
  • value  14930000
    address  32E6QaiMpRYH6bsD3ojMeLfmhhDr2eEmx6
  • 7ae5765ffca625f03f7ea80609e2defd8ef9fc656c5c9a32c713479518bfa9ac:1
  • value  710956159
    address  3McLxjCe31iwzaEN8UumYRzJLnfXSvppbb